Output 64feecd5f6a706721bdf99df3d7e3dcce7a3af4d3e2a6743ca1e12dca96bc25d:0

value
3995972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ae66431d2f74dec2a8c754ca7ad6abcd2503b53e OP_EQUAL
address
3HbA1Dpxz3Xg1tRp4qFh77Ax7wrCbqLpFC
transaction
64feecd5f6a706721bdf99df3d7e3dcce7a3af4d3e2a6743ca1e12dca96bc25d
spent
true